Egyptian news outlet Fil Goal has revealed that Mohamed Salah will be named in the FIFPro World XI after being nominated alongside six other Liverpool stars.

Alisson Becker, Trent Alexander-Arnold, Andy Robertson, Virgil van Dijk, Roberto Firmino, Mohamed Salah and Sadio Mane were all named in the 55-man list last week.

If Fil Goal is to be believed, it’s hugely exciting to hear that Salah will be included in FIFPro’s World XI even if he arguably deserved to be included in 2018 a lot more than he does this year.

The Egyptian enjoyed a stunning 2018/19 campaign, scoring and assisting 37 goals in all competitions, including a goal in the Champions League final in Madrid last season.

Not to mention his stunning goals in the Premier League like the thunderbolt he scored against Chelsea in the Reds’ exhilarating title race with Manchester City.

The Egyptian, signed from AS Roma for £36.9million in 2017, has been one of the best players on the planet for the last two seasons and has been the best attacker in the Premier League since he returned to England after a couple of seasons in Serie A.

He might have deserved to be included in FIFPro’s World XI more in 2018 than he does this year but there is no denying that he is a worthy winner all the same.
